An upward-angled, slightly rotated image captures a traditional, dark-hued, multi-tiered Japanese pagoda under an overcast sky, likely in Kyoto, Japan. The pagoda dominates the left side of the frame, showcasing its distinctive tiered roofs with ornate eaves and dark tiles. Small white specks are visible against the dark roofs and sky, possibly indicating rain or dust. At street level, a wooden fence or wall runs across the middle and right sections of the image, adorned with green foliage and trees behind it. A dark street lamp post stands near the fence. Several road signs are visible: a blue circular sign indicating "no entry for bicycles" and a red circular sign with a blue background and red diagonal line, typically meaning "no stopping or parking." Below these, a brown rectangular sign clearly states "歩行者道路" (Pedestrian Road) with smaller text specifying "土曜・日・休日" (Saturdays, Sundays, and Holidays) and "10-17" (10:00 to 17:00), indicating pedestrian-only hours. Further along the fence are several information boards, including a yellow one and a white one with a map or diagram. Text on one of the boards identifies it as a "京都市広報板" (Kyoto City Bulletin Board) and provides an address: "東山区 八坂道下河原東入八坂上町" (Higashiyama Ward, Yasaka-michi Shimo-kawara Higashi-iru Yasaka-kami-cho). Another visible line of text reads "京都東山観光飲無運路を守る会," likely an association for preserving local roads or tourism routes. A partially visible red umbrella and a clear umbrella, held by an unseen person, suggest rainy weather. The overall scene depicts a historic street during an overcast daytime, with elements of traditional architecture and modern urban signage.
